Description

The Supplier will supply vehicles that will fulfil the requirements set out by UKAEA for the role the vehicle is required for (See appendix 10)
UKAEA's policy is to use fully electric vehicles though it is understood that at this time there are a limited number of vehicles with this capability and that there may not be a suitable fully electric vehicle available that can retain enough charge to enable up to 8 hours work a day without the need to recharge during the working day. There may also be an issue with availability of an electricity supply for recharging therefore UKAEA may choose alternative fuelled vehicles if necessary. As the vehicles are used inside diesel/petrol is not an option.
